Articulate, intimate, written with honest directness, these letters lay bare Vincent van Gogh's dramatic life, providing remarkable insights into the creative process and touching revelations of his personal anguish. The Complete Letters of Vincent van Gogh was first published by New York Graphic Society in 1958. Among the most distinguished books ever published, it is still the only complete edition of the letters in English. Illustrated by over two hundred ink drawings that the artist sketched into his letters, the collection has been the source of numerous biographical and fictional works, but none has matched the intensity of the original material. Most of the letters were written to the artist's brother, Theo, and it was Theo's son, Vincent, who acted as consulting editor for the publication. A touching memoir by Theo's wife serves as the introduction.
